Posted November 13, 2018 Share Posted November 13, 2018 https://www.cnn.com/2018/11/12/us/baraboo-high-school-nazi-salute-trnd/index.html Quote Baraboo police tweeted that they are assisting the district's investigation since being made aware of a "controversial photo of a group of high school students." Not everyone in the photo is participating in the gesture. Jordan Blue, a student in the top right of the image whose hands are not raised, told CNN the photo was taken as students gathered at a local courthouse for professional prom photos. "The photographer said to raise your hand, but he didn't say a specific way, and my peers should not have raised it in the specific way that was the offensive way and hurtful way," Blue said. Blue said the gesture made him uncomfortable and scared. "It was a scary moment, and it was very shocking and upsetting, and it was a huge misrepresentation of the school district and the community of Baraboo," he said.
